Day-01: Delhi to Manali (530 Km | 12-14 Hours) Overnight Journey
Begin your Shimla Kullu Manali Tour Package with a comfortable overnight Volvo journey from Kashmiri Gate or Majnu Ka Tila in Delhi. Volvo buses usually depart between 4:30 PM to 10:00 PM, subject to the confirmed service schedule. Please arrive at the designated boarding point at least 30 minutes before departure. Exact pick-up details, reporting time and travel assistance information will be shared in advance.

Day-02: Local sightseeing at Manali
Reach Manali in the morning. At the bus stand, you will be received and dropped off at the hotel. Check-in will be at noon. Take a half-day local sightseeing after some rest. Pay a visit to the Hadimba Temple, the site of antique architectural structures and a quiet atmosphere. Tour the Club House, which has indoor activities and recreation facilities.
Visit the Tibetan Monastery, Van Vihar, Manu Temple, Shiv Temple, Jogini Waterfall, and Vashist Temple with its natural hot springs and religious status. In the evening, walk through the Mall Road where you can make purchases, visit cafes, and taste the local life. Spend the night in a hotel in Manali.
Day-03: Solang Valley – Rohtang Pass – Atal tunnel
Post breakfast, leave on a full-day tour of Solang Valley, Kothi Village, Nehru Kund, Him Valley, Apple Garden and Suiting Point. In Solang Valley, one may involve oneself in adventure sports like – paragliding, zorbing, snow scooter, skiing, and horse rides.
Curious tourists can also take a stroll to “Anjani Mahadev”. Drive through the Atal Tunnel and go to SISSU. Travelers can also visit Rohtang Pass to observe snowy scenery under the conditions of a permit.
Please note: Since the National Green Tribunal is allowing only a limited number of vehicles to Rohtang Pass per day. Rohtang Pass will be subject to the availability of permit on the spot with fresh cost on a participating basis or individual basis as per guest demand.
Day-04: Manali – Kullu – Kasol – Manikaran
The day will commence with breakfast and all-day voyaging to Kullu, River Rafting Point, Vaishno Devi Temple, Kullu Market and Shawls Factory. And go to Kasol Market and have a glimpse of Parvati Valley. Tour the Manikaran Sahib Gurudwara, which has holy hot springs and a spiritual atmosphere. Go back to Manali in the evening. Overnight stay at the hotel.
Day-05: Manali — Kullu — Shimla
Check out from the hotel and take a drive to Shimla. The most visited tourist destinations on the way are Kullu, Pandoh Dam, Hanogi Devi Temple, Sunder Nagar Lake, Kullu Valley, Vaishno Devi Temple, Shawls Factory and Rafting Point. Arrive in the afternoon in Shimla, enter into the hotel. Overnight stay in Shimla.
Day-06: Shimla – Kufri – Local and Departure
Go sightseeing after breakfast, including – Green Valley, Indira Tourist Park, Himalayan Nature Park, Chini Bungalow, Himalayan Bird Park (Himalayan Aviary), Chadwick Falls, Mashobra, Naldehra and KUFRI, and the 2,622-meter-high location, which is also the main attraction due to its picturesque views.
Then visit the Mall Road and The Ridge, which have a panoramic view of the mountain. See such sights as – Christ Church, Library Building, Jakhu Hill & Temple, Sankat Mochan Temple, and the Institute of Advanced Study.
During the evening, have leisure time for shopping. Take the Volvo AC bus to Delhi between 07:00-10: 00 PM. Taxi service between the hotel and the bus stand will be offered.
Day-07: Arrival in Delhi
Arrive in Delhi around 7:00-8:00 AM. The tour will be remembered with good memories of the landscapes, culture, and experiences of Himachal.

Major Destinations and Activities
Shimla– Kufri, Mall Road, Jakhoo Temple, Ridge, Mashobra, Naldehra and structures constructed during the colonial era.
Manali– Solang Valley (paragliding, zorbing, snow sports), Rohtang Pass / Atal Tunnel (seasonal), Hadimba Devi Temple, Old Manali cafes and Markets.
Kullu– Picturesque valleys, river rafting, handicrafts of the locals, and famous shawl factories.
Best Time to Visit
March to June – This is a good season and the weather is very good for sightseeing and doing outdoor activities.
September-November – lush green sceneries and fewer people.
December-February – The most favorable months of snowfall, snow activities and winter photography.
